25 | Licensing Program Analysts (LPAs), Saraliz Velando and Renita Rodriguez conducted an unannounced Annual Licensing Inspection. LPAs were greeted at the front door by licensee, Olga Levenzon. LPAs were granted entry after identifying themselves and disclosing the purpose of the visit. There were 4 children present. Licensee is using the following areas for daycare: Child’s room, backyard, Bedroom 1, and bathroom 1. The following areas are off-limits to children: Bedroom 2, office, bathroom 2, Front Yard, Patio, Living room, Kitchen, and Garage. These areas are inaccessible to children by baby safety gates, locked doors, and doorknob covers. The children are provided a safe, healthful, and comfortable environment, furnishings, and equipment. Business Hours are Monday-Friday, 8am -5pm.
There is a fire extinguisher in the kitchen area that meets regulations. LPAs did not observe any bodies of water on the premises. Licensee stated there are no weapons or ammunition stored on the premises and LPAs did not observe any.
Storage for poisons, detergents, cleaning solutions, medications are inaccessible by doorknob covers for off limit rooms, safety latches, and baby safety gates. Licensee provided a fire/disaster drill log that shows last drill was conducted on 9/27/22. The home is kept clean and orderly with heating and ventilation for safety and comfort.
Licensee has no infants currently on her roster. Pediatric CPR and First Aid cards for provider and helper expire 10/1/24. Licensee could not provide a Mandated Reporter training certificate for herself and her helper. There is a working telephone and email address. |
